Ладно, вопросы отпали. Но версия 6 - стремная. Строки с ошибкой выводит неправильно. А еще входит в инсталяшку MASM9
Скачал MASM9 тут: http://spiff.tripnet.se/~iczelion/files/m32v9r.zip Инсталятор подтвердил что это именно MASM32 version 9 Release Но в комплекте...
скачал SDK к IDA, такой плагин написать - пара пустяков. Ида знает сколько параметров берет ф-я(хоть она из импорта, хоть из тела) например retn 8...
Ну да, мысля понята правильно. Это нужно для реверсинга. Просто invoke Sleep,100 было бы и понятнее и запись короче. А вот у декомпилеров есть...
C-- http://c--sphinx.narod.ru Напишешь #jumptomain NONE main() { } Получишь самый минимум И никто не запрещает return(0); написать или же EAX=0;
Может кто видал плагин, который бы мог преобразовать push/call в invoke ? Вроде бы это реально, но что-то гугл об этом не знает.
Низнаю как сейчас, но мне винда никогда не запрещала ЧИТАТЬ нулевой сектор, а серийник как раз там. А вот с записать проблемы были, приходилось с...
Вообще такого готового полно: WinLirc winlirc.sourceforge.net Girder girder.nl PC Remote Control pcremotecontrol.com Sly Control slydiman.narod.ru...
что то гдето и чемто это - lpDIKeyboard.SetCooperativeLevel(Wnd, DISCL_FOREGROUND or DISCL_EXCLUSIVE); в самой игре. Как обойти в данном случае...
Просто reason в примере указан явно, DLLEntryPoint(DLL_PROCESS_ATTACH);, в других языках программирования такое не используеться, оно принимаеться...
На С-- это выглядит примерно так #jumptomain NONE //неважное поскипанно dword main ( dword hInstDLL, reason, reserv ) { switch(reason){ case...
В том то и прикол, что изначально точка входа указывает на строчку после begin, а тут она переопределяется после передачи управления на нее. Не ну...
Есть такой кусок кода на дельфях, как его правильно на асм перевести ( если быть точнее мне C-- нужен) procedure DLLEntryPoint(dwReason: DWord);...
Имена участников (разделяйте запятой).